基于智能监控框架的自媒体热点追踪系统实践

一、技术背景与痛点分析

在自媒体运营领域,内容创作效率与选题质量直接影响账号的商业价值。根据行业调研数据,超过70%的运营者将”选题策划”列为最耗时的环节,平均每天需要投入1.5-2小时进行热点追踪。传统人工监控方式存在三大痛点:

  1. 时效性不足:热点生命周期缩短至15-30分钟,人工采集存在明显延迟
  2. 覆盖面有限:单个运营者难以同时监控10个以上内容平台
  3. 分析维度单一:仅凭经验判断热点潜力,缺乏数据支撑

某智能监控框架(基于开源项目二次开发)的出现为解决这些问题提供了技术基础。该框架具备三大核心能力:

  • 多源异构数据采集
  • 实时流式处理
  • 机器学习模型集成

二、系统架构设计

系统采用微服务架构设计,包含四个核心模块:

1. 数据采集层

通过定制化爬虫集群实现多平台数据采集,支持:

  • 动态渲染页面处理:采用无头浏览器技术获取JS渲染内容
  • 反爬策略应对:集成IP池、User-Agent轮换、请求间隔控制
  • 增量采集机制:基于时间戳的增量更新,减少无效请求
  1. # 示例:微博热搜采集配置
  2. class WeiboSpider:
  3. def __init__(self):
  4. self.base_url = "https://s.weibo.com/top/summary"
  5. self.headers = {
  6. "User-Agent": "Mozilla/5.0 (Windows NT 10.0; Win64; x64)"
  7. }
  8. def fetch_data(self):
  9. response = requests.get(self.base_url, headers=self.headers)
  10. soup = BeautifulSoup(response.text, 'html.parser')
  11. # 解析热搜榜单逻辑...

2. 热度分析层

构建多维热度评估模型,包含:

  • 基础指标:搜索量、讨论量、传播速度
  • 情感分析:NLP模型判断话题情感倾向
  • 传播路径:基于图计算的传播树分析
  1. 热度评分 = 0.4*搜索量 + 0.3*讨论量 + 0.2*传播速度 + 0.1*情感系数

3. 概率预测层

采用XGBoost算法构建爆文预测模型,特征工程包含:

  • 历史爆文相似度
  • 话题时效性衰减系数
  • 平台特性适配度
  • 竞品账号参与度

模型在测试集上达到87%的准确率,AUC值为0.92。

4. 消息推送层

集成多通道推送机制:

  • 钉钉机器人:支持Markdown格式消息卡片
  • 企业微信:自定义应用消息推送
  • 邮件服务:定时生成热点分析报告

三、关键技术实现

1. 动态配置管理

采用配置中心实现监控规则的热更新:

  1. # 监控规则配置示例
  2. rules:
  3. - platform: "zhihu"
  4. keywords: ["AI", "区块链"]
  5. threshold: 5000 # 热度阈值
  6. interval: 300 # 采集间隔(秒)

2. 异常处理机制

构建三级容错体系:

  1. 采集层:自动重试+失败队列
  2. 处理层:熔断机制+降级策略
  3. 存储层:死信队列+人工干预通道

3. 性能优化方案

  • 异步处理:采用消息队列解耦采集与分析
  • 缓存策略:Redis缓存热点数据,QPS提升300%
  • 水平扩展:容器化部署支持动态扩缩容

四、运营效果评估

系统上线后取得显著成效:

  1. 效率提升:选题时间从120分钟/天缩短至15分钟/天
  2. 内容质量:爆文产出率提升40%,平均阅读量增长65%
  3. 覆盖范围:监控平台数量从3个扩展至12个

典型运营数据对比:
| 指标 | 优化前 | 优化后 | 提升幅度 |
|———————|————|————|—————|
| 日均选题数 | 3个 | 8个 | 167% |
| 爆文产出率 | 12% | 17% | 42% |
| 运营成本 | 5人时 | 2人时 | 60% |

五、扩展应用场景

该技术方案可扩展至多个领域:

  1. 品牌监测:实时追踪品牌相关话题
  2. 竞品分析:监控竞争对手内容策略
  3. 舆情预警:设置负面关键词自动告警
  4. 行业研究:生成行业热点趋势报告

六、技术选型建议

对于不同规模团队的技术选型建议:

  1. 个人运营者:轻量级部署(单节点+SQLite)
  2. 中小团队:容器化部署(Docker+K8s)
  3. 大型企业:分布式架构(消息队列+分布式计算)

存储方案对比:
| 方案 | 优点 | 缺点 |
|———————|—————————————|—————————————|
| 关系型数据库 | 事务支持好 | 高并发场景性能受限 |
| 时序数据库 | 写入性能高 | 复杂查询支持较弱 |
| 对象存储 | 成本低廉 | 随机访问性能差 |

七、未来优化方向

系统持续优化计划包含:

  1. 多模态分析:增加图片/视频内容理解能力
  2. 跨平台关联:构建话题传播全链路图谱
  3. 智能创作:集成AI辅助写作功能
  4. 预测市场:建立热点价值评估模型

通过这套智能监控系统的实施,自媒体运营者可将更多精力投入到内容创作本身,而非重复性的热点追踪工作。技术团队可根据实际需求选择合适的开源组件进行二次开发,在保证系统灵活性的同时,有效控制开发成本。建议从核心功能开始逐步迭代,通过MVP(最小可行产品)验证技术方案可行性后再进行全面推广。